RIVERDALE, NY - Taking the court for the first time in the new year, the Yeshiva Men's Basketball Team downed the University of Mount Saint Vincent, beating the Dolphins by a score of 80-74 on Sunday, Jan. 4th.
The Maccabee offense was led by a trio of scorers, with
Zevi Samet,
Yair Dovrat, and
Yoav Oselka all putting up double digits. Samet led the way with 19, while Dovrat and Oselka dropped 16 and 13 respectively.
Both Samet and Oselka also had stellar days on the defensive side of the ball. Samet led the squad with six steals, while Oselka came just one rebound short of a double-double at nine, also tacking on two steals and a block of his own in the process.
With the result, the Macs are now 4-7, 3-0 in conference play.
HOW IT HAPPENED
- The score remained close through the first few possessions, with UMSV taking a 4-3 lead on a jumper just under two minutes nto the contest. However, just 14 seconds later, Max Zakheim nailed a three to put Yeshiva up 6-4, an advantage the Maccabees would never cede back to their conference foe.
- Yeshiva's lead remained steady throughout the majority of the period, peaking at nine points at 24-15 with 9:11 remaining. The shooting of Dovrat, Oselka, Samet, and Or Sundjyvsky kept the potent UMSV offense at bay, not allowing the Dolphins to come closer than three points through the final 10 minutes of the period. The Macs ended the half with a five-point run, heading into the break up 43-33 thanks to a triple and a pair of free throws from Dovrat.
- Yeshiva's lead would balloon through the first ten minutes of the second half, reaching as many as 15 points at 48-33. However, despite YU's edge sitting at a comfortable 13 points with just over five minutes left in regulation, UMSV fought back.
- Slashing into the Macs' advantage with a 17-6 run, the Dolphins shrank the margin between the two squads down to just two points at 76-74 with 26 seconds left, leaving the Maccabees little margin for error. Used to high pressure situations though, thanks in part to their grueling non-conference schedule, the Macs kept a cool head. A pair of free throws each from both Zakheim and Dovrat sealed the game, sending Yeshiva home with another Skyline win, 80-74.
